CRANBERRY ORANGE POUND CAKE
This Cranberry Orange Pound Cake is so moist and is perfect for the winter and holiday season!
Provided by Nikki
Categories Dessert
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
- In a large bowl, cream butter, sugar and orange zest together for 3 to 5 minutes.
- Add eggs one at a time and beat an addition minute per egg.
- Add vanilla and mix in.
- In a separate large bowl, mix and combine dry ingredients together.
- Add dry ingredients alternatively with the buttermilk to the butter/sugar/orange zest/egg mixture. Fold in cranberries.
- Grease and flour either 2 large bread pans or 3 small bread pans.
- Pour batter and bake at 350 degrees F for 55 to 60 min.
- Let loaves cool and pour glaze over them.
- Whisk glaze ingredients together until smooth.
CRANBERRY-ORANGE POUND CAKE
At the summer tourist resort my husband and I operate in Ontario, we prepare all the meals for our guests, so I'm always trying out new recipes. -Sheree Swistun, Winnipeg, Manitoba
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 1h30m
Yield 16 servings (1-1/2 cups sauce).
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y, about 5 minutes.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Stir in vanilla and orange zest. Combine flour, baking powder and salt; add to creamed mixture alternately with sour cream. Fold in cranberries. , Pour into a greased and floured 10-in. fluted tube pan. Bake at 350° for 65-70 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ack to cool completely., In a small saucepan, combine sugar and flour. Stir in cream and butter; bring to a boil over medium heat, stirring constantly. Boil for 2 minutes. Remove from the heat and stir in vanilla. Serve warm over cake.

ORANGE-CRANBERRY BUNDT CAKE
Provided by Jeff Mauro, host of Sandwich King
Categories dessert
Time 1h40m
Yield 10 to 12 servings
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Grease and flour a bundt pan.
- Mix together the orange zest and juice, orange liqueur and eggs in a large bowl and set aside. In a smaller bowl, toss the cranberries with 1 tablespoon of the flour and set aside.
- In a stand mixer with a paddle attachment, add the sugar, baking powder, salt, baking soda and remaining 2 1/2 cups flour and mix to combine. On low speed, slowly add the butter 1 tablespoon at a time and continue to mix until a pea-sized crumble texture is achieved. Turn the speed to medium and slowly stream in the egg/orange mixture until combined. Increase the speed to medium high and beat until light and fluffy, about 2 minutes. Gently fold in the cranberry mixture. Pour the batter into the prepared bundt pan and smooth out the top.
- Bake until a cake tester inserted in the cake comes out clean, 50 to 55 minutes. Let cool in the pan for 20 to 30 minutes, then remove the cake and serve.
CRANBERRY-ORANGE POUND CAKE
Cake mix and instant pudding mix speed the prep of this irresistibly rich crimson-studded pound cake.
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Dessert
Time 2h35m
Yield 16
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Heat oven to 325°F. Grease and flour 12-cup fluted tube cake pan, or spray with baking spray with flour.
- In large bowl, beat cake mix, pudding mix, water, softened butter, orange peel and eggs with electric mixer on low speed 30 seconds, scraping bowl constantly, then on medium speed 2 minutes, scraping bowl occasionally. Fold in cranberries. Spread in pan.
- Bake 57 to 65 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 15 minutes; remove from pan. Cool completely, about 1 hour. Sprinkle with powdered sugar.
- In 1-quart saucepan, cook sauce ingredients over medium heat about 4 minutes, stirring constantly, until thickened and bubbly. Serve warm or cool sauce with cake. Store cake loosely covered at room temperature and sauce covered in refrigerator.

LEMON POUND CAKE
Add a splash of sunshine to any spring brunch or dessert spread with this bright lemon pound cake. Yellow cake mix is combined with cream cheese and grated lemon peel for a pound cake that's rich in flavor and bursting with refreshing citrus notes. With just six simple ingredients and only 15 minutes of prep time, you can whip up this lemon pound cake recipe when you want to bake something homemade, but don't have all day to do it.
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Dessert
Time 2h25m
Yield 12
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Heat oven to 325°F. Generously spray bottom only of 9x5-inch loaf pan with baking spray with flour.
- In medium bowl, beat cake mix, cream cheese, water, grated lemon peel and eggs with electric mixer on low speed 1 minute, scraping bowl frequently, then on medium speed 2 minutes, scraping bowl occasionally. Pour into pan.
- Bake 50 to 60 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ool in pan 10 minutes. Remove from pan to cooling rack or heatproof serving plate. Cool completely, about 1 hour.
- In small microwavable bowl, microwave frosting uncovered on High 10 to 15 seconds or until frosting is thin enough to drizzle; stir. Spoon frosting evenly over cake, allowing frosting to drip down sides.

ORANGE-CRANBERRY POUND CAKE
Start a weekend morning with this exquisitely rich and pretty pound cake, with delicate orange and tangy cranberry flavors.
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Breakfast
Time 3h
Yield 16
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Heat oven to 350°F. Grease and flour 9x5-inch loaf pan. In large bowl, beat butter and 3/4 cup granulated sugar with electric mixer on medium speed 3 minutes until light and fluffy.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Add orange juice and vanilla; beat 30 seconds or until well blended.
- Add flour, baking powder and salt; beat on low speed 30 seconds or just until blended. With spoon, fold in cranberries and orange peel. Spoon batter into pan. Sprinkle with coarse sugar.
- Bake 50 to 55 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 15 minutes. Remove from pan to cooling rack. Cool completely, about 1 hour 30 minutes.
